Scarcity of natural coarse aggregate has initiated the use of recycled aggregate obtained from crushed concrete rubbles in building industry. The quality of recycled aggregate concrete (RAC) produced depends on the quality of recycled aggregate obtained from old concrete. Several methods such as acid treatment, thermal treatment, mechanical treatment, etc. are available to improve the quality of recycled concrete aggregate. This paper aims to compare the effect of treatment methods on the bond strength of reinforcement with concrete. Fifteen numbers of RILEM beam specimens are prepared using natural aggregate, untreated recycled aggregate, recycled aggregate treated with acid, mechanical and thermal methods. The physical, mechanical properties of these aggregates, their compressive strength and bond strength are determined and the optimum results are presented in this paper.
